N8 7QB is a residential postcode located on High Street, London, N8. It is the 558th largest postcode in the N8 area.
It contains 37 flats and 11 unknown and the most common type of property is a period flat built between 1800 and 1911.
The average house value is £441,088. Sales values have increased in the last 12 months by 3.1% and Rental values have increased by 5.6%.
Property sale values range from £219,952 for a studio leasehold flat of 205 square feet and has a balcony to £754,208 for a leasehold flat, with 3 bedrooms split across 1,141 square feet of gross internal area and has a garden.
Average £/ft2 for properties in N8 7QB is £765/ft2.
Properties achieve a rental yield of between 5% and 6%, and rental values range from £980 to £3,117 per month.
The last sale was 13 Sep 2023 for £668,686 and since then the market in the area has increased by 3%. The postcode has had a total of 4 sales since 1995.
N8 7QB has seen 2 sales in the last three years and no sales in the last twelve months.
